  • Experimental introspection — Wundt's laboratory instruments

    Wundt's Leipzig laboratory equipped psychology with its first set of tools: the tachistoscope (flash stimulus presentation), the chronoscope (reaction-time measurement), and systematic self-report (trained introspection). These instruments operationalized the first measurable psychological variables — reaction time, attention span, sensory threshold — and established that mental processes could be studied as rigorously as physical ones. The American graduates who trained with Wundt (James McKeen Cattell, G. Stanley Hall, Edward Titchener) brought the experimental model back to US universities in the 1880s-1890s. The tools were instruments of science, not clinical practice; the gap between Wundt's laboratory and Witmer's 1896 Penn clinic represents the distance from measurement to help.

    Effect on the work

    The laboratory era created the occupation's scientific legitimacy — the credential that would, decades later, justify the doctoral requirement for licensure. Without Wundt's experimental foundation, the APA might have become a guild of practitioners rather than a scientific society, and the case for doctoral-level training would have been far harder to make.

  • Standardized psychometric tests — Stanford-Binet (1916), Army Alpha/Beta (1917), Rorschach (1921), MMPI (1943)

    Lewis Terman's 1916 Stanford revision of Binet's intelligence scale was the first standardized, normed psychometric instrument in American practice. The Army Alpha and Beta tests (1917-1918) — developed by Robert Yerkes, Lewis Terman, and a committee of psychologists for the classification of 1.7 million WWI recruits — demonstrated that psychological testing could operate at industrial scale and be consequential for major institutional decisions. Hermann Rorschach's inkblot test was published in 1921; the MMPI (Hathaway and McKinley, University of Minnesota) in 1943. By WWII's end, clinical psychologists had a testing toolkit that psychiatrists did not have and could not easily acquire: normed, scored, validated instruments for measuring personality, pathology, and cognitive capacity. This toolkit was the occupation's competitive moat — and it remains so today, when interpretation of the MMPI-2 (567 items, requiring doctoral-level training) or a Halstead-Reitan neuropsychological battery cannot legally be signed off by a master's-level counselor in most states.

    Effect on the work

    The psychometric era created the assessment work surface that still employs a significant fraction of licensed psychologists — forensic assessment, disability evaluation, neuropsychological testing, educational placement, and court-ordered evaluation. This work is both AI-resistant (interpretation requires legal licensure and clinical judgment calibrated against normative datasets) and economically significant: a full neuropsychological evaluation can bill $3,000-$6,000.

  • Doctoral training institutionalization — Boulder Model (1949), VA clinical system

    World War II was the occupation's decisive forcing function. The United States went from having no formal university programs in clinical psychology in 1946 to over half of all PhDs in psychology being awarded in clinical psychology by 1950. The Veterans Administration, confronting hundreds of thousands of returning veterans with psychological injuries, needed doctoral-level practitioners at a scale that simply did not exist. NIMH training grants (1946 National Mental Health Act) paid for graduate programs. The Boulder Conference (August 20 – September 3, 1949, University of Colorado at Boulder) convened to standardize what those programs should produce: the scientist-practitioner model, a four-year sequence combining psychology foundation, therapeutic principles, supervised internship, and research dissertation. The doctoral degree became the non-negotiable entry credential. Every state licensing law for psychologists passed after 1949 incorporated the doctoral requirement.

    Effect on the work

    The Boulder model created the credential gate that has kept this occupation small (~76,000 in 2024) relative to adjacent mental health roles (~483,000 Mental Health Counselors). The 4-7 year doctoral pipeline cannot surge quickly to meet demand — the same constraint that explains why psychologist supply has grown slowly even as mental health demand has expanded rapidly since 2008.

  • PsyD degree (Vail Conference 1973) — practitioner-scholar split

    By the early 1970s, the scientist-practitioner model's assumption that all clinical psychologists would be both researchers and clinicians was under strain. Many graduates trained under the Boulder model ended up in full-time clinical practice and never published research. The 1973 Vail Conference on Professional Training in Psychology, convened in Vail, Colorado, endorsed a second doctoral track: the Doctor of Psychology (PsyD), designed explicitly for clinical practice rather than research. The PsyD emphasized "practitioner-oriented coursework," accepted larger cohorts, and allowed graduates to sit for the same licensing exams as PhDs. The practical effect: total doctoral output in clinical and counseling psychology began growing faster in the 1970s-1980s as PsyD programs proliferated at professional schools of psychology (not just research universities). By 2020, PsyD graduates outnumbered clinical PhD graduates in many states.

    Effect on the work

    The PsyD expanded supply of licensed doctoral psychologists while creating a persistent internal credential debate: research universities regard PhD as the gold standard; professional schools grant PsyD and argue practice-readiness is equivalent. For licensing, assessment authority, and insurance reimbursement, the credentials are interchangeable in most states. The PsyD reduced the average time to licensure from 6-8 years (PhD) to 5-6 years (PsyD), modestly accelerating pipeline throughput.

  • Tarasoff duty to warn (1976) + managed care reimbursement battles

    On July 1, 1976, the California Supreme Court handed down its ruling in Tarasoff v. Regents of the University of California — holding that mental health professionals have a duty to protect third parties when a patient poses a credible threat of harm. Justice Tobriner wrote that "the public policy favoring protection of the confidential character of patient-psychotherapist communications must yield to the extent to which disclosure is essential to avert danger to others." The decision had no precedent and alarmed the clinical community. It created an entirely new legal obligation for every licensed psychologist: when a patient threatens a specific person, the clinician must act — warn the victim, notify law enforcement, or take other reasonable protective measures. By 2012, 23 states had codified duty-to-warn statutes. Simultaneously, the managed-care revolution of the 1990s pushed insurers to restrict access to higher-cost doctoral-level psychologists for routine therapy, preferring lower-cost master's-level providers. Psychologists responded by emphasizing assessment work (Rorschach, MMPI, neuropsychological batteries) that only doctoral-level practitioners could legally sign — a strategic pivot to the highest-moat segment of their scope of practice.

    Effect on the work

    Managed care compressed psychotherapy reimbursement for psychologists relative to psychiatrists (who could also prescribe and thereby justify higher billing) and relative to master's-level counselors (who were cheaper). Psychologists moved toward assessment-intensive practices and supervisory roles. The managed-care era was a wage-stagnation period for private-practice psychologists relative to inflation.

  • Mental Health Parity Act + ACA — insurance mandate era

    The Mental Health Parity and Addiction Equity Act (2008) required insurers to apply identical financial requirements and treatment limits to mental health and substance use disorder benefits as to medical/surgical benefits. The Affordable Care Act (2010) designated mental health care as an essential health benefit. For psychologists, the practical effect was significant: doctoral-level assessment and psychotherapy services became more consistently reimbursable for a broader insured population. However, the parity regime also brought more administrative burden — prior authorizations, utilization review, documentation requirements — that added unpaid overhead to private practice. The net employment effect was positive: from approximately 68,000 (2010) to 74,400 (2019), a modest but sustained recovery from the managed-care contraction.

    Effect on the work

    The ACA expansion did more for master's-level counselors (who saw near-doubling of their workforce 2010-2019) than for doctoral psychologists, whose pipeline remains gated by the 4-7 year training requirement. Psychologists' comparative advantage in the parity era was assessment: a full neuropsychological evaluation, legally restricted to doctoral practitioners, generates 10-15x the revenue of a 50-minute therapy hour and cannot be contracted to a lower-cost provider.

  • AI therapy chatbots — Woebot (2017), Wysa (2017), Replika (2017)

    Three AI-powered mental health tools launched in the same year: Woebot (Alison Darcy, Stanford, 2017), Wysa (Bangalore, 2017), and Replika (Eugenia Kuyda, San Francisco, 2017). The substitution question they raised is sharper for doctoral-level psychologists than for master's counselors in one specific respect: psychologists' claims to be uniquely irreplaceable rest substantially on (1) the testing battery (AI cannot sign a neuropsychological report) and (2) severe and complex presentations requiring differential diagnosis at the doctoral level. For routine talk therapy with mild-to-moderate presentations — which psychologists also do — the AI chatbot question is essentially the same as it is for counselors. The evidence base as of 2026 does not support AI chatbot equivalence to human therapy for any clinical population beyond mild subclinical distress; the Fitzpatrick et al. (2017) RCT of Woebot (n=70, college students, PHQ-9 reduction vs. an informational ebook control, two weeks) is still the landmark study, and it explicitly cannot answer whether AI matches a licensed psychologist for moderate-to-severe presentations.

    Effect on the work

    AI chatbots served the "worried well" population that psychologists rarely treat anyway — mild subclinical distress, daily stress management, sleep hygiene. The clinical population (moderate-to-severe depression, trauma, personality disorders, psychotic spectrum, neuropsychological impairment) requiring doctoral-level assessment and treatment was not materially addressed by any AI product as of 2026. Psychologist employment was unaffected by the 2017-2020 chatbot wave.

  • COVID-19 telehealth normalization + 2024 APA AI practice guidelines

    The COVID-19 pandemic forced the rapid adoption of telehealth delivery across all mental health professions, including doctoral psychologists. CMS telehealth waivers (March 2020) enabled interstate practice and eliminated the requirement that psychologists be licensed in the patient's state for the duration of the public health emergency — a temporary regulatory change that opened a sustained policy debate about interstate licensure compacts for psychologists. The mental health crisis that COVID accelerated (NIMH: 23.1% of US adults with any mental illness in 2022, the highest recorded rate) created a documented supply gap; a KFF survey found 27% of adults who needed mental health services did not receive them, with 60% citing lack of providers accepting insurance as the primary barrier. Into this environment, OpenAI integrations into clinical platforms (2024-2025) introduced LLM-powered note generation, treatment plan drafting, and patient psychoeducation tools — augmenting documentation workflows without touching the assessment or judgment core of the psychologist's work. In 2024, the APA published practice guidelines explicitly warning that AI should not be used as a substitute for licensed clinical care, positioning the association firmly on the augmentation rather than substitution side.

    Effect on the work

    BLS projects +11.2% growth for clinical and counseling psychologists 2024-34 — much faster than average. The 2024-34 National Employment Matrix projects 76,300 employed in 2024 growing to 84,800 by 2034 (8,500 net new positions, 4,800 annual openings including replacement). Primary demand drivers per BLS: aging population requiring neuropsychological evaluation; expanded insurance coverage under ACA and MHPAEA; persistent population-level mental health crisis; and growing recognition that complex presentations require doctoral-level assessment that AI tools cannot replicate.

BLS National Employment Matrix 2024-34
2034
+11%
BLS Employment Projections 2024-34 cycle. Employment: 76,300 (2024) projected to 84,800 (2034), +8,500 net new positions (+11.2%). Annual openings: 4,800 (new jobs + replacement demand). Classified as "much faster than average (7% or higher)." Primary BLS demand drivers: aging population requiring neuropsychological evaluation for dementia, TBI, and stroke; continued expansion of insurance coverage under ACA and MHPAEA for mental health services; and population-level mental health crisis driving demand for doctoral-level diagnosis and treatment planning. Healthcare and social assistance accounts for 80.7% of current employment. This is the most authoritative near-term baseline.
AI assessment disruption scenario (pessimistic tail)
2034
-5%
Speculative lower-bound scenario: if AI-powered psychometric scoring platforms (automated MMPI-2 interpretation, computer-adaptive neuropsychological assessment, and AI-assisted Rorschach scoring via the Exner Comprehensive System) advance to the point where regulators accept AI-generated assessment reports without a licensed psychologist's interpretive signature, the most automation-resistant segment of the psychologist's work surface is at risk. This scenario requires regulatory change (state licensing boards explicitly permitting AI-signed psychological assessments) that has not begun as of 2026, and is opposed by APA practice guidelines explicitly issued in 2024. Even under this scenario, the therapeutic and crisis-intervention functions of clinical psychologists — where the APA and licensing boards are firmly opposed to AI substitution — remain human-delivered. The -5% represents suppressed employment growth, not absolute job loss. This scenario is included for intellectual honesty about the assessment automation tail risk, not as a likely forecast.

AI is sitting alongside you hereDraft session progress notes, treatment plans, and discharge summaries using AI-assisted documentation — reviewing an AI-drafted SOAP or DAP note produced by Eleos Health or Upheal from the session ambient transcript, correcting clinical inaccuracies, adding observations not captured by the AI (client affect, non-verbal cues, session-process observations), and attesting to accuracy before EHR filing

Draft session progress notes, treatment plans, and discharge summaries using AI-assisted documentation — reviewing an AI-drafted SOAP or DAP note produced by Eleos Health or Upheal from the session ambient transcript, correcting clinical inaccuracies, adding observations not captured by the AI (client affect, non-verbal cues, session-process observations), and attesting to accuracy before EHR filing. Treatment plan scaffolds from Blueprint Companion are reviewed for individualization and clinical rationale.[8],[4]

Where your edge is

AI documentation tools (Eleos, Upheal, Blueprint) are now deployed at LifeStance Health and other large doctoral-level outpatient group practices; the task shifts from note-writing to note-validation and clinical attestation. Add the clinical nuance the AI misses: paralanguage, ambivalent affect, session process (what happened to the alliance this session, not just what was discussed), and the clinical impression that drives the next intervention decision. Under APA Ethics Code Standard 9.01 and APA Technology Guidelines (2025), you are accountable for all records bearing your signature regardless of how the first draft was produced.

AI is sitting alongside you hereConduct structured clinical intake assessments for new patients — administering standardized self-report instruments (PHQ-9, GAD-7, PCL-5, AUDIT-C, DAST-10) with AI pre-scoring from intake platforms (Spring Health AI Compass, Limbic Access in managed behavioral health contexts), reviewing AI-pre-scored results, synthesizing quantitative scores with the clinical interview, and formulating a preliminary DSM-5-TR working diagnosis with differential diagnosis and level-of-care recommendation.

Conduct structured clinical intake assessments for new patients — administering standardized self-report instruments (PHQ-9, GAD-7, PCL-5, AUDIT-C, DAST-10) with AI pre-scoring from intake platforms (Spring Health AI Compass, Limbic Access in managed behavioral health contexts), reviewing AI-pre-scored results, synthesizing quantitative scores with the clinical interview, and formulating a preliminary DSM-5-TR working diagnosis with differential diagnosis and level-of-care recommendation.[19],[20]

Where your edge is

AI intake tools now pre-score standardized measures before the first psychologist contact; your intake starts with structured data in hand. The doctoral-level contribution is synthesizing the quantitative profile with interview presentation — particularly identifying discrepancies between self-report and interview (clients often minimize or over-report based on secondary gain), constructing a differential diagnosis with multiple competing hypotheses, and determining whether the presentation warrants full psychological testing. The algorithm's care-routing recommendation is a triage tool; the psychologist's differential formulation is the clinical product.

School Psychologists

Clinical psychologists who develop interest in pediatric and developmental assessment, learning disabilities, and ADHD evaluation can transition into School Psychology practice, where doctoral-level psychologists hold a specialized role above master's-level school psychologists (EdS) in conducting comprehensive psychoeducational evaluations (IDEA-compliance evaluations, specific learning disability eligibility determinations, autism spectrum evaluations) and providing consultation to school systems. Doctoral school psychologists (PhD/PsyD in school psychology or clinical psychologists with NCSP certification) have a differentiated credential in K-12 and university settings. The slightly lower CRI reflects school psychology's lower practice complexity ceiling vs. clinical and the master's-level competition in the occupation code, but school-based roles offer strong job security (BLS projects +6% growth for school psychologists), state pension systems, and PSLF-eligible loan forgiveness for those in public schools.

What you'd add
  • · NCSP (Nationally Certified School Psychologist) credential — requires graduate degree in school psychology + 1,200 supervised hours + PRAXIS exam; relevant for clinical psychologists without a school psych degree who want the credential
  • · Psychoeducational assessment: WIAT-III/KTEA-3 (academic achievement), WJ-IV (cognitive + academic), CTOPP-2 (phonological processing), GFTA-3 (articulation) — school-specific battery
  • · IDEA compliance and special education law: eligibility determination criteria for SLD, ADHD, autism, emotional disturbance, intellectual disability under federal and state regulations
  • · School consultation models: problem-solving team consultation, CBM (curriculum-based measurement) for progress monitoring, tiered support system (MTSS/RTI) design
  • · Report writing for IEP teams: translating neuropsychological findings into IDEA-compliant eligibility determinations and specific, actionable IEP goal recommendations
